@MichauxOutdoors7 ай бұрын
Hey, I'm 5'7" and ride the FE350s with just the lowered seat. The suspension does break in over time. I tend to mount the bike with a running start versus trying to sit on the bike from standing still. The suspension is awesome. My goal is not to lower it. Now, with roughly 1,000 miles on the bike, I'm comfortable and don't intend to lower. Hope this helps.

@MichauxOutdoors Жыл бұрын
I had a KTM 500exc and wanted a lighter bike for the dirt and single track. When I bought the 500exc, I was mostly riding sand and wanted the extra horsepower. Really enjoyed the 500, paid off in the sand, but was noticeably heavier than the 350. Today, I'm doing mostly woods riding - more single track and technical riding, so I went with the FE350s. The 350 was the right choice for me for woods riding. The bike is noticeably lighter and more nimble. The 350 horsepower and torque will surprise you. If I had to do all over again, I'd get the 350 for dirt or sand. Appreciate you watching
